Harley-Davidson 300cc Cruiser – What We Know So Far

In March 2019, Harley-Davidson and China’s Qianjiang Group had entered into a partnership to develop small and mid-capacity motorcycles. The American motorcycle manufacturer was previously working on 338R naked streetfighter with its Chinese partner. However, the project was reported to be shelved and both companies started working on a new twin-cylinder sportster. Internally named SRV300, the upcoming Harley Davidson 300cc cruiser will be positioned against the Royal Enfield 350cc motorcycles.

 Recently, the sketches of the new Harley Davidson 300cc bike were emerged on the web revealing some interesting details. The model features a retro-styled circular headlamp flanked by beefy forks. It has bobber-like lower positioned seat with the extended rear fender. Features such as wide handlebars, black alloy wheels with black spokes, forward-set footpegs and blacked-out treatment on mechanical elements further enhance its sporty looks.

Harley Davidson 300cc Roadster

The Harley Davidson SRV300 is likely to come with all LED lighting system, a TFT instrument cluster with Bluetooth connectivity for turn-by-turn navigation. It will have inverted forks and twin rear shock absorbers, swingarm for performing suspension duties. The Harley Davidson 300cc bike’s braking system is likely to include front and rear disc brakes with the standard dual-channel ABS (anti-lock braking system).

Official engine details are still under the wraps. If reports are to be believed, the upcoming Harley Davidson 300cc cruiser will come with a new 296cc, water-cooled, overhead-cam V-twin motor delivering power close to 30bhp. It will be capable to attain a top speed of 129kmph.The model is reported to carry a low kerb weight of 163kgs that translates into healthy power to weight ratio and spirited performance. It will have a 1400mm long wheelbase. The bike will be assembled with 16-inch front and 15-inch rear tyres.
